Polarization characteristics of graded thick Ba1 − xSrxTiO3 films
The barium strontium titanate ceramics Ba 1 − x Sr x TiO 3 with a spatially variable composition has been prepared according to the thick film technology (tape casting). The strontium content over the film thickness is varied from 0 to 30 mol %. The structure and polarization characteristics of the...
